Arbonics

Arbonics connects landowners and carbon credit buyers to facilitate data-driven carbon removal projects in forestry. The platform offers services for both establishing new forests through afforestation and optimizing existing forests for carbon sequestration and biodiversity enhancement. They utilize comprehensive data models incorporating satellite and sensor information to ensure verified carbon impact and accountability for all participants.

Problem

European landowners face challenges in accurately assessing and managing the carbon sequestration potential of their land and forests. The complexity and cost associated with traditional carbon credit verification processes hinder their ability to participate in carbon markets and generate revenue from sustainable land management practices.

Solution

Arbonics offers a data-driven platform that enables landowners to analyze and optimize carbon sequestration through afforestation and impact forestry. By integrating diverse data sources, including landowner data, satellite imagery, and remote sensing, Arbonics' platform provides a comprehensive assessment of carbon capture potential. The platform facilitates the generation of verifiable carbon credits, allowing landowners to access carbon markets and unlock new revenue streams through sustainable forest management. Arbonics' technology monitors planting, growth, and overall project success, fostering trust and accountability in nature-based carbon solutions.

Target Audience

Arbonics primarily targets forest and landowners in Europe seeking to optimize carbon sequestration and generate income through carbon credits, as well as companies looking to purchase verified, nature-based carbon credits.

Features

  • Data models for afforestation, identifying optimal areas for new forests.
  • Custom planning for existing forests to enhance carbon removal and biodiversity.
  • Analysis of land's carbon absorption capacity using multiple data sources.
  • Monitoring of planting, growth, and project success using landowner data, satellites, and remote sensors.
  • Facilitation of carbon credit generation certified by verification providers like Verra.
  • Platform analyzes the carbon opportunity of land in under a minute.
